bärförmågetestning
Bärförmågetestning refers to the process of evaluating the load-bearing capacity of a structure or material. This testing is crucial in engineering and construction to ensure that a component or system can safely withstand the intended forces and stresses it will encounter during its operational life. The primary goal is to prevent structural failure, which can have catastrophic consequences, including damage to property, injury, or loss of life.
